Nokia Launches Ovi Store Worldwide
The world’s largest mobile phone manufacturer, Nokia has finally launched its Ovi Store worldwide. Nokia Ovi Store is a marketplace for Nokia to launch an application, music, video, widget and ringtone. As the same time, it allows Nokia users to download free and paid application to their Nokia handsets which running on Symbian S40 and S60 operating systems. For instance, the Nokia phones running on Symbian S60 including 5800 XpressMusic, the latest E-series and N-series smartphones as well as imminent N97.

In addition, the Nokia Ovi Store also provides third party application developers an easy way to distribute and monetize their applications to Nokia users all over the world. The Nokia is offer 70% of revenue sharing to developer which similar to Apple app store. Currently, there have a number of applications are available to download at Ovi Store.
Nokia Ovi Store is expected to be available for US users by later this year through AT&T network.
